This article shows the connection and interrelation between complexity theory and knowledge management. It is planned to find mechanisms to communicate and share knowledge efficiently, improving knowledge management in a complex system such as the development software factories. As a result, it propose a model of knowledge management, taking into account notions of complexity theory applied to a development system software factories, where normal development involves different forms of complexity, which must be managed properly to help solve. Of course, the results of the application can be seen in the medium term best practices and lessons learned. © 2013 Springer-Verlag.
